A. Schoening is a scholar working on Hardware and Architecture, Computer Networks and Communications and Artificial Intelligence, having authored 3 papers that have together received 26 indexed citations. Recurring topics across this work include Advanced Data Storage Technologies (2 papers), Network Packet Processing and Optimization (2 papers) and Parallel Computing and Optimization Techniques (1 paper). The work is most often cited by research in Hardware and Architecture (13 citations), Nuclear and High Energy Physics (17 citations) and Computer Networks and Communications (18 citations). A. Schoening has collaborated with scholars based in Germany, United States and Italy. Frequent co-authors include H.K. Soltveit, G. Volpi, E. Bossini, A. Stabile, S. J. Dittmeier, P. Giannetti, Valentino Liberali, M. Beretta, M. Piendibene and R. Tripiccione. Their work appears in journals such as CINECA IRIS Institutial research information system (University of Pisa) and Archivio Istituzionale della Ricerca (Universita Degli Studi Di Milano).
